The Doom Patrol, #119
1964 Series - DC, May-June 1968, coverprice 0.12, 36 pages.
Doom Patrol feature story: "In the Shadow of the Great Guru"
Credits:
Arnold Drake (Script), Bruno Premiani (Pencils), Bruno Premiani (Inks), ? (Colors), ? (Letters).
Synopsis:
The Doom Patrol battle a hypnotist, which results in Madame Rouge's evil personality taking control of her body.
Character appearances:
Doom Patrol [The Chief [Niles Caulder]; Elasti-Girl [Rita Farr]; Negative Man [Larry Trainor]; Robotman [Cliff Steele]]; Madame Rouge; Mento [Steve Dayton]; Beast Boy [Gar Logan]; Yaramishi Rama Yogi (villain)
Reprinted: in Doom Patrol Archives, The (DC, 2002 series) #5 (July 2008)
